本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。
使用挂载助手在 Amazon EC2 Linux 实例上EFS挂载
此过程需要满足以下条件:
-
您已经在EC2实例上安装了
amazon-efs-utils
软件包。有关更多信息,请参阅 手动安装 Amazon EFS 客户端。 -
已为文件系统创建挂载目标。有关更多信息,请参阅 管理挂载目标。
在 EC2 Linux 实例上使用挂载帮助程序挂载您的 Amazon EFS 文件系统
-
通过 Secure Shell (SSH) 在您的EC2实例上打开终端窗口,然后使用相应的用户名登录。有关更多信息,请参阅 Amazon EC2 用户指南中的 Connect 到您的EC2实例。
使用以下命令创建要用作文件系统装载点的目录
efs
:sudo mkdir efs
-
运行以下命令之一来挂载文件系统。
注意
如果EC2实例和要挂载的文件系统位于不同的 AWS 区域 s 中从不同的服务器挂载EFS文件系统 AWS 区域,请参阅编辑
efs-utils.conf
文件中的region
属性。要使用文件系统 id 来装载,请执行以下操作:
sudo mount -t efs
file-system-id
efs-mount-point
/使用要安装的文件系统的 ID 代替
file-system-id
efs
efs-mount-point
.sudo mount -t efs fs-abcd123456789ef0 efs/
或者,如果要使用传输中的数据加密,您可以使用以下命令挂载文件系统。
sudo mount -t efs -o tls fs-abcd123456789ef0:/ efs/
要使用文件系统DNS名称进行装载,请执行以下操作:
sudo mount -t efs -o tls
file-system-dns-name
efs-mount-point
/sudo mount -t efs -o tls fs-abcd123456789ef0.efs.us-east-2.amazonaws.com efs/
-
使用挂载目标 IP 地址挂载:
sudo mount -t efs -o tls,mounttargetip=
mount-target-ip
file-system-id
efs-mount-point
/sudo mount -t efs -o tls,mounttargetip=192.0.2.0 fs-abcd123456789ef0 efs/
可以在附加对话框中查看和复制用于挂载文件系统的确切命令。
在 Amazon EFS 控制台中,选择要挂载的文件系统以显示其详细信息页面。
要显示用于此文件系统的挂载命令,请选择右上角的附加。
附加屏幕显示用于通过以下方式挂载文件系统的确切命令:
(通过挂载 DNS)将文件系统的DNS名称与EFS挂载助手或NFS客户端一起使用。
(通过 IP 装载)在NFS客户端上使用所选可用区中的挂载目标 IP 地址。